Position Summary:
Reviews analyzes, evaluates, validates provider/producer information against business/credentialing requirements and maintains information on Credentialing databases. Supports extensive research and analysis of sensitive provider/producer issues; addresses data integrity issues.
Job Description
Assist with reviewing, analyzing, and validating provider/producer information to ensure it meets credentialing and business requirements
Maintain and update provider/producer records in credentialing databases with a high level of accuracy
Support research and review of provider/producer information, escalating sensitive or complex issues as needed
Help identify and correct data discrepancies to support overall data integrity and compliance
Handle confidential and sensitive information with professionalism, discretion, and care
Organize and prioritize assigned tasks to me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ment
Draft and respond to basic professional correspondence, including emails and routine notices
Communicate effectively with providers, internal staff, and management under guidance and supervision
Work independently on routine tasks while seeking guidance for new or complex issues
Use Microsoft Office applications (Word, Excel, Access) and internet resources to research and maintain information
Demonstrate strong attention to detail and willingness to learn credentialing policies, procedures, and systems
